Eligibility To Get Help Single Mothers For Housing

To be eligible for single mothers Help for housing, there are certain requirements that must be met. These requirements can vary depending on the specific program or organization offering the assistance, but some of the most common eligibility criteria include:

Income

Single mothers must demonstrate that their income falls below a certain threshold. This is typically determined based on the area median income (AMI) for the region in which they live. Most programs require that participants have an income that is less than 80% of the AMI.

Family size

The size of the family is also taken into account when determining eligibility. Many programs prioritize families with children, and the number of children in the household can impact eligibility.

Legal status Single mothers must be legal residents or citizens of the United States to be eligible for most Help single mothers for housing programs.

Housing status

Some programs may require that single mothers are homeless or at risk of becoming homeless in order to be eligible for assistance.

How To Get Help Single Mothers For Housing?

If you are a single mother in need of housing assistance, there are several steps you can take to access Help single mothers for housing programs. The process can vary depending on the program or organization offering the assistance, but some of the most common steps include:

Research available programs

Start by researching the available Help single mothers for housing programs in your area. You can do this by searching online or contacting local non-profit organizations that specialize in housing assistance.

Determine eligibility

Once you have identified a program that may be a good fit, review the eligibility criteria to ensure that you meet the requirements.

Apply for assistance

Most Help single mothers for housing programs require an application process. Wait for approval

Depending on the program, it may take several weeks or months to receive a decision on your application. Be patient and stay in communication with the program staff to ensure that your application is being processed.

Sign a lease

If your application is approved, you will typically be asked to sign a lease for the housing unit. This lease will outline the terms of the agreement, including rent payments, maintenance responsibilities, and any other requirements.

Organization That Help Single Mothers For Housing

Help single mothers for housing programs are available throughout the United States, but the specific programs and organizations offering assistance can vary by state and region. Some of the most common sources of Help single mothers for housing assistance include:

U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D)

HUD offers a variety of programs and resources for low-income families, including Help single mothers for housing options. You can search for local HUD-approved housing counseling agencies on their website.
